Research topic
Each PhD Fellow will be affiliated to the NCS2030 centre in one or more of the following topics:
1) Characterization of tight petroleum reservoirs:
This project aims to elucidate how modified brines (“Smart Water”) alter liquid–liquid and liquid–solid interfacial behaviour in low permeable porous media. Wettability and capillary forces depend non-linearly on mineral surface chemistry, brine composition, and the distribution of ions and impurities in the interfacial region. Because these interactions arise from specific ion–surface interactions, predictive insight requires advanced models on atomic-scale resolution. The case of study will be selected from tight petroleum reservoirs on the Norwegian continental shelf. Development strategies should be proposed and tested, accounting for determinant conditions such as low permeability and the interplay with rock-fluid properties and chemistry.

2) CO2 -enhanced oil recovery and storage in depleted petroleum fields:
In this project, you will investigate and aim to optimize CO2-assisted oil production (CO2EOR) and subsequent CO2 storage. Simplistic models for a fundamental understanding of the processes will be initially constructed and then progressively developed and applied to the Norwegian continental shelf.[ND1] The main methodology is compositional multiphase reservoir simulations combined with production optimization[ND2] . The methodology shall indicate optimal well closure times and when to convert or drill new wells to maximize hydrocarbon production. This should be done by keeping as much of the CO2 and water in the reservoir before pure CO2 injection is performed. The aim is thus to optimize economic outcomes and CO2 storage, deliver guidelines for doing so, and propose strategies for fields on the Norwegian continental shelf.

3) Characterization of aquifers:
This is a multidisciplinary project that aims to improve key knowledge and regional distribution of aquifers in sedimentary sequences on the Norwegian continental shelf. Aquifers are part of the same pressure systems as other reservoirs and influences all subsurface activities linked to production of hydrocarbon reservoirs and CO2 storage. Characterization of aquifer conductivity, ion and gas composition are needed to improve subsurface management, and the potential of critical element extraction from produced water.

4) Proxy models for CO₂ sequestration
This project will develop data-driven proxy models for CO₂-sequestration forecasting in regional aquifers. It aims to approximate full-physics simulations and update predictions using observational pressure and seismic data. The approach combines physical modelling and machine learning, using regional aquifer models from the Norwegian continental shelf. Applications include scenario testing, uncertainty evaluation, and real-time model updating for CO₂-injection planning. The work integrates geosciences, reservoir engineering, and data science.

Requirements for competence in English
A good proficiency in English is required for anyone attending the PhD program. International applicants must document this with a valid test certificate from one of the following tests:
- TOEFL – Test of English as a Foreign Language, Internet-Based Test (IBT). Minimum result: 90
- IELTS – International English Language Testing Service. Minimum result: 6.5
- Certificate in Advanced English (CAE) or Certificate of Proficiency in English (CPE) from the University of Cambridge
- PTE Academic – Pearson Test of English Academic. Minimum result: 62
The following applicants are exempt from the above requirements:
- Applicants with one year of completed university studies in Australia, Canada, Ireland, New Zealand, United Kingdom, USA
- Applicants with an International Baccalaureate (IB) diploma
- Applicants with a completed master's degrees taught in English in a EU/EEA country
- Applicants who are exempt based on HK-dir's GSU list
